Excel VBA宏编程实例:获取光标坐标的源代码
版权申诉
ZIP格式 | 14KB |
更新于2024-11-22
| 136 浏览量 | 举报
本资源是一个专注于Excel-VBA宏编程的实用教程和实例代码集合,以获取光标所在位置的坐标为应用场景。Excel VBA(Visual Basic for Applications)是微软Office办公自动化解决方案中的一项强大功能,允许用户通过编程控制和扩展Office软件的功能,特别是Excel。本资源主要面向希望通过VBA编程来提升工作效率和进行办公自动化的用户,适合有一定Excel使用基础和希望学习宏编程的初学者。
VBA宏编程知识点总结:
1. VBA编程基础
- VBA是基于Visual Basic的编程语言,主要用于Office系列软件的自动化处理。
- 在Excel中,VBA可以用来创建宏(Macro),实现数据的自动化处理、自定义功能和自动化任务等。
2. Excel VBA环境设置
- 首先需要确保Excel的宏功能已经被启用,这通常在Excel的“选项”菜单中的“信任中心”中设置。
- 打开VBA编辑器的方式是在Excel中按下快捷键`Alt + F11`。
3. 编写VBA代码
- VBA代码是在VBA编辑器中编写的,可以处理各种Excel对象,如工作表(Worksheet)、工作簿(Workbook)、单元格(Range)等。
- VBA代码通常由一系列过程(Procedures)组成,过程分为Sub(子程序)和Function(函数)两类。
4. VBA中的事件
- VBA中的事件是指在用户执行某些操作时自动触发的代码,如打开工作簿时、点击按钮时等。
- 本资源中的实例代码涉及到的事件可能是工作表的选择事件(Worksheet Selection Change)。
5. 获取光标所在位置坐标
- 在Excel VBA中,可以使用`ActiveCell`对象来获取当前活动单元格的信息。
- `ActiveCell`对象的`Row`和`Column`属性可以用来获取当前单元格的行号和列号,从而得到光标所在位置的坐标。
6. Excel VBA宏编程高级应用
- 宏可以用于自动化重复性的任务,例如数据排序、筛选、计算等。
- VBA还支持用户自定义的界面元素,如窗体(UserForm)、控件(Control)等。
7. 宏的管理与安全
- 在使用宏时,需要考虑宏的安全性问题,比如避免宏病毒。
- 通过设置宏的安全级别可以限制宏的执行,确保只有可信的宏可以运行。
8. 实例代码解析
- 本资源中的实例代码展示了如何编写一个宏来获取并显示光标所在位置的坐标信息。
- 代码可能包含一个触发事件的过程,当用户在Excel工作表中选择单元格时,宏会自动运行并显示坐标的函数。
- 可能使用了`MsgBox`函数来弹出消息框显示坐标的行号和列号。
9. 实际应用案例
- 在办公自动化场景中,通过VBA宏实现特定功能可以极大提升工作效率,如自动汇总数据、格式化报告等。
- 可以通过VBA宏来创建自定义的解决方案,以适应特定的工作流程或需求。
通过本资源的学习和实践,用户可以掌握如何使用VBA编程来实现对Excel数据的有效处理,并通过获取光标位置的坐标来进一步扩展Excel的自动化操作。对于希望提高办公自动化水平和编程能力的用户来说,这是一个实用且具有指导意义的教程和代码库。
相关推荐








芝麻粒儿
- 粉丝: 6w+
最新资源
- 掌握MATLAB中不同SVM工具箱的多类分类与函数拟合应用
- 易窗颜色抓取软件:简单绿色工具
- VS2010中使用QT连接MySQL数据库测试程序源码解析
- PQEngine:PHP图形用户界面(GUI)库的深入探索
- MeteorFriends: 管理朋友请求与好友列表的JavaScript程序包
- 第三届微步情报大会:深入解析网络安全的最新趋势
- IQ测试软件V1.3.0.0正式版发布:功能优化与错误修复
- 全面技术项目源码合集:企业级HTML5网页与实践指南
- VC++6.0绿色完整版兼容多系统安装指南
- 支付宝即时到账收款与退款接口详解
- 新型不连续导电模式V_2C控制Boost变换器分析
- 深入解析快速排序算法的C++实现
- 利用MyBatis实现Oracle映射文件自动生成
- vim-autosurround插件:智能化管理代码中的括号与引号
- Bitmap转byte[]实例教程与应用
- Qt YUV在CentOS 7下的亲测Demo教程